Sebastian Maniscalco – Borgata Event Center, Atlantic City

Nov 10-12, 16-18

Sebastian Maniscalco, the “king of physical comedy”, strikes a chord with millions because his material is strongly influenced by his Italian-American familial upbringing. His routines undoubtedly evoke a sense of nostalgia and comfort. Maniscalco’s animated storytelling style, along with his perfect comedic timing and exaggerated facial expressions, can turn mundane scenarios into comedic gold.  Maniscalco will perform at AC’s Borgata later this month.

Nikki Glaser – Sound Waves at Hard Rock Hotel & Casino, Atlantic City

November 11

Known for her raunchy and risqué humor that dives into sex, sobriety and insecurities, Nikki Glaser is shaking up the stage in Atlantic City, NJ at the Hard Rock Hotel and Casino for her upcoming, “The Good Girl Tour”. Glaser is undoubtedly a rising star in the comedy sphere. Between her Netflix special “Bangin”, iconic Comedy Central celebrity roasts, and the host of the reality dating show FBOY Island, you won’t want to miss whatshe has in store next.

Pete Davidson – Hackensack Meridian Health Theater , Englewood Performing Arts Center 

November 18 and 19

Aside from his impressive dating roster making headlines, Staten Island native and SNL star Pete Davidson is gaining more traction as a standup comic. His confessional-like style, where he discusses his drug use, dating life, and mental health struggles, makes him a likable and relatable character. You can catch Pete performing at the Hackensack Meridian Health Theater on November 18 and at Englewood Performing Arts Center on November 19.

Lewis Black – Wellmont Theater Montclair, NJ

December 8 

Funny and furious Lewis Black is making an appearance at the Wellmont Theater in Montclair, NJ, for his “Off the Rails” tour. Black is best known for his comedy routines that escalate into hilarious angry rants about politics, government, cultural trends—basically anything that ticks him off. Something about his grumpy demeanor is endearing and gives the audience permission to engage in a ragefully cathartic experience.
